On Thu, Feb 19, 2026 at 10:52:20PM -0500, Sean Anderson wrote: > On 2/19/26 22:12, Fabio Estevam wrote: > > From: Fabio Estevam <[email protected]> > > > > Add support for loading the next stage from an MTD device in SPL. > > > > Introduce CONFIG_SPL_MTD_LOAD and a generic SPL MTD loader > > implementation that uses the MTD subsystem to read the U-Boot payload. > > > > The loader works with any MTD-backed storage, including raw NAND and > > SPI NAND, without being tied to a specific NAND type. > > > > The payload offset defaults to CONFIG_SYS_MTD_U_BOOT_OFFS and can be > > overridden via the device tree property: > > > > u-boot,spl-payload-offset > > > > To support both raw NAND and SPI NAND boot flows, the loader is > > registered for BOOT_DEVICE_NAND and BOOT_DEVICE_SPI. This allows it > > to operate correctly on platforms where the ROM reports either NAND > > or SPI as the boot source while using the same MTD-based loading > > infrastructure. > > > > The required NAND core and SPI NAND drivers are built for SPL when > > CONFIG_SPL_MTD_LOAD is enabled. > > > > This provides reusable infrastructure for boards that boot from MTD > > devices without relying on SPI-specific or NAND-specific SPL loaders. > > > > Signed-off-by: Fabio Estevam <[email protected]> [snip] > > diff --git a/common/spl/Makefile b/common/spl/Makefile > > index 4c9482bd3096..67fc1cd1b396 100644 > > --- a/common/spl/Makefile > > +++ b/common/spl/Makefile > > @@ -35,6 +35,7 @@ obj-$(CONFIG_$(PHASE_)NVME) += spl_nvme.o > > obj-$(CONFIG_$(PHASE_)SEMIHOSTING) += spl_semihosting.o > > obj-$(CONFIG_$(PHASE_)DFU) += spl_dfu.o > > obj-$(CONFIG_$(PHASE_)SPI_LOAD) += spl_spi.o > > +obj-$(CONFIG_SPL_MTD_LOAD) += spl_mtd.o > > Does this need a $(PHASE_)? (I don't know, but the others have it)
For consistency yes, even if we're unlikely to need this in TPL too. -- Tom
